A STRANGE AFFAIR.

(UNITED PRESS ASSOCIATION.) ' Wellington, July 10. Mr A. L. Levy J.P., Secretary of the Wellington branch of the Temperance Alliance has been missing since Thursday ~3j and nothing has been heard of him sin re. On Wednesday last Mr Levy and the members of the Conk Licensing Cnininictee each received a letter threatening that thcit lives would he taken if they, persisted m thoir determination to. close the three hotels m the district. No reason is known for the absence, whioh is causing anxiety to his friends. The matter has been placed m the hands of the police,
